Hayami, Shinya;Kato, Kazuya;Ohba, Masaaki
The cobalt(II) compounds with long alkyl chains, [Co(C12-terpy)(2)](BF4)(2)center dot EtOH center dot 0.5H(2)O(1 center dot EtOH center dot 0.5H(2)O) and [Co(C12-terpy)(2)](BF4)(2) (1) was synthesized and characterized. The compound 1 center dot EtOH center dot 0.5H(2)O exhibits a "re-entrant spin crossover". The compound 1 exhibits the re-entrant spin crossover and multi phase transitions with a wide thermal hysteresis loop.
